Abstract
Summary: A novel copolymer containing perylene bisimide and porphyrin units was synthesized through a Wittig‐type coupling reaction and characterized. An electrochemical experiment showed its electronic properties. Optoelectronic measurements showed a steady and rapid cathodic photocurrent response of the polymer film. The features of copolymer colloids were also studied by UV‐Vis spectrometry and TEM. A large quantity of nanoparticles were observed with TEM, with a mean diameter of 200 nm. The size effect leads the absorption wavelength of the nanoparticles to be red‐shifted, which is consistent with the results of UV‐Vis spectrometry.
